Output ecb62ae4bb93776369f20b05d4725f3b350fafc89d9ad3363d03f01543f24a04:0

value
620017157
script pubkey
OP_0 OP_PUSHBYTES_20 cb7eaff6138860c05350f1d704fd1d13cb31921c
address
bc1qedl2lasn3psvq56s78tsflgaz09nrysu24qyy2
transaction
ecb62ae4bb93776369f20b05d4725f3b350fafc89d9ad3363d03f01543f24a04
spent
true